The Sam Walton Community Scholarship is also another scholarship program that you may be interested in pursuing. Through 4 years, $13,000 can be awarded to qualifying dependents of Walmart associates. The minimum ACT score is a 22 and proof of need of financial aid is also required.
The Rotary International Ambassadorial Scholarship provides up to $26K in scholarship money. To be eligible, you need to submit writing work in dramatic script, journalism, and humor. To get the scholarship, applicants need to have a 2.5 or more GPA and show financial need.
